Step-by-Step Installation

  1. Choose Installation Location: Select a location with proper air circulation, away from heat sources and direct sunlight.
  2. Check Clearance: Ensure at least 20 inches of clearance on all sides for optimal airflow and performance.
  3. Level the Unit: Place on a flat, level surface to prevent water leakage and ensure proper operation.
  4. Connect Drain Hose: Attach drain hose for continuous drainage or use built-in water tank for manual emptying.
  5. Electrical Connection: Connect to a properly grounded 115V, 60Hz outlet. Use dedicated circuit if possible.
  6. Initial Setup: Allow unit to stand upright for 24 hours before first use if transported horizontally.
  7. Test Run: Run the dehumidifier for 30 minutes to check for proper operation and drainage.

Specifications

Model Series DH50K1G
Type Compressor Dehumidifier
Color White / Gray
Capacity 50 Pints per day (at 60% RH, 80°F)
Noise Level 48 dB
Control Type Digital Controls with LED Display
Energy Rating Energy Star Certified
Water Tank Capacity 1.6 Gallons
Power Requirements 115V, 60Hz, 4.5A
Dimensions (HxWxD) 24.2 x 15.4 x 11.3 inches
Weight 40.8 lbs
Operating Temperature 41°F to 95°F

Key Features

Auto Restart

Automatically resumes previous settings after power interruption, ensuring continuous dehumidification without manual reset.

Auto Defrost

Intelligent defrost system prevents ice buildup on coils in low-temperature environments, maintaining optimal performance.

Continuous Drain Option

Built-in drain port allows for continuous water removal using standard garden hose, eliminating manual tank emptying.

24-Hour Timer

Programmable timer allows you to set start and stop times for energy efficiency and customized operation schedules.

Washable Filter

Removable and washable air filter captures dust and particles, improving air quality while reducing maintenance costs.

Humidity Control

Precise humidity settings from 35% to 80% RH allow you to maintain ideal moisture levels for comfort and health.

Operating Modes Explained

Auto Mode

Automatically maintains set humidity level by adjusting fan speed and compressor operation

Turbo Mode

Maximum dehumidification power for quickly reducing high humidity levels in damp areas

Quiet Mode

Reduced fan speed for quiet operation during nighttime or in living areas

Dryer Mode

Enhanced drying function for laundry rooms or areas requiring extra moisture removal

Continuous Mode

Runs continuously until manually turned off, ideal for very damp conditions

Smart Mode

Energy-saving mode that optimizes operation based on room conditions and usage patterns

Troubleshooting

Problem Possible Cause Solution
Dehumidifier won't start Power issue, full water tank, timer setting Check power supply, empty water tank, check timer settings
Poor dehumidification Dirty filter, low temperature, closed doors Clean air filter, ensure room temperature above 41°F, keep doors open
Water not collecting Low humidity, incorrect settings, drainage issue Check room humidity, verify settings, check drain hose for kinks
Unit freezing up Low room temperature, dirty filter Move to warmer area, clean filter, allow auto defrost to work
Unusual noises Loose parts, debris in fan, unbalanced unit Check for loose components, clean fan area, ensure unit is level
Error codes displayed Sensor issues, system faults Refer to error code guide, reset unit, contact service if persistent

Error Codes

  • E1: Temperature sensor error - Check sensor connection
  • E2: Humidity sensor error - Verify sensor operation
  • E3: Full water tank - Empty tank and restart
  • E4: Fan motor error - Check fan for obstruction
  • E5: Compressor error - Wait 3 minutes and restart
  • E6: Defrost system error - Contact service center
